A Four Season Paradise

Green mountains, long sandy beaches, traditional villages and snowy slopes characterise the beautiful region of Pelion. The mythological land of the Centaur, Mount Pelion is full of hiking trails, springs, gorges and streams.

During winter you can visit the ski resort of Agriolefkes, which has 4 slopes and ski lifts in constant operation. Situated to the northern side of Pelion, Pelion Ski Resort offers stunning views of the Aegean Sea.

During summer, you can relax on the crystal clear beaches on the east coast and southern part of the peninsula. Milopotamos beach is surrounded by a picturesque landscape with large rocks and greenery, while the long sandy beach of Horefto has deep blue waters and several facilities for swimmers.

A perfect combination of mountain and sea, Pelion has around 24 villages including Makrinitsa, Portaria, Tsagarada, Zagora, Chorefto and Afissos. All villages have traditional houses with thick stone walls, tiny windows and roofs covered with grey slate. Most of the houses are decorated with fine artwork, carpets and antiques. Very beautiful traditional Greek mountain village with small shops (local products) and few restaurants. Difficult to find parking in the center of the village, one public parking but it's very small. Easy to make road trips around Pelion area - go around if you have a car, this is one of the most beautiful regions in Greece (also in summer, not only winter). Some part of the roads (in Pelion area, not in Portaria) were destroyed in winter 2024 during storms. Unfortunately, they were still destroyed in July 2024. You can go around by car, roads are not closed, but needs a bit attention in many places and wouldn't recommend to drive at night (dark). Time from Portaria to beach (Agios Ioannis, Papa Nero) took from us abt 40 min so take your time. To Village "Kala Nera" (nice beach, long with plenty of place in July) a bit less.

Tsagarada is a charming village, renowned for its extraordinary natural beauty and unique setting. Settled in the heart of a chestnut forest, it attracts many visitors during the summertime who come to enjoy its peaceful atmosphere, breathtaking views and offering of an excellent traditional cuisine deeply rooted in the Pelion region’s rich culinary heritage. Founded in 1500, Tsagarada is composed of four picturesque settlements, each centered around beautifully restored old churches: Taxiarches, Agia Paraskevi, Agia Kyriaki, and Agios Stephanos. These churches are notable for their exquisite wooden carved iconostases. Tsagarada offers a perfect blend of nature, history, and tradition, making it a truly unforgettable destination.

Zagora is famous for its apples, and agriculture is the main occupation for the majority of inhabitants; anyway, it is rich in historic churches too. There are some very good restaurants and Chorefto is a long beach at the crystal waters of the Aegean sea (though we must admit that the sea is frequently too rough).
